## Releases

Tenlimit releases ship monthly. Each release bundles the per-tenant rate quota config, so quota changes only take effect after a tagged release is deployed. Support can confirm which quota set a tenant is on from the release manifest. Verify the manifest signature with the key below.

release key, hahig-tahop: bky9_M2QMJ6LkR

## Runbook: Blue-green deploys for the Tallowbill billing worker

Plugin authors should know the Tallowbill worker runs two identical pools, "cobalt" and "moss." Traffic cuts over only after the idle pool drains its retry queue and passes the reconciliation probe. Plugins must tolerate both pools being briefly active, since in-flight invoices finish on the old pool. Never flip the router manually; the orchestrator handles it. The pool selection and drain behavior are governed by the values below.

service settings:
PRAIX_LOG_LEVEL=error
PRAIX_METRICS_HOST=metrics.praix.qorvelcorp.corp
PRAIX_POOL_SIZE=16

**Q: Why do clients reconnect in a loop after the Hollyvane gateway restarts?**

A: A known bug in versions prior to 4.2.1 causes the websocket handshake to reuse a stale session token, triggering repeated reconnects. The fix ships in release 4.2.1. Rollout status and affected client versions are tracked on the internal page below.

operations page: https://jenkins.zemvarcloud.local/job/merge_requests/repo/build/73930b4b30f0a8ed

# Legacy Pricing Uplift — Restricted

Scope: all customers on pre-2021 Marwick plans. Uplift: staged increase over two renewal cycles, capped per the approved matrix. Comms go out thirty days before each renewal; support has escalation scripts. Expected attrition is within tolerance per the Elsinore model. Do not offer discounts outside the matrix without sign-off. Incoming director: ownership of exception approvals transfers to you at month end. The commercial rationale behind the cap levels is recorded in the confidential note below.

internal memo for tajof-kaduf: Only 65 of the 511 pilot accounts renewed Lamdor, so a churn review is set for January 26. Aldmirek Works is in early talks to buy Alddorox Works for about $490.9 million.